This is a fully mature benchmark Second Growth from Pauillac: the prestigious Château Pichon-Longueville Baron 1997 (commonly known as Pichon Baron). Widely celebrated as one of the definitive "Super Seconds" of the Médoc, Pichon Baron is famous for crafting wines of intense power, muscular structure, and profound cabernet purity. The 1997 vintage produced exceptionally charming, approachable, and harmonious expressions across Bordeaux, and this bottle has evolved into a glorious plateau of peak tertiary drinking maturity. The nose opens with an inviting bouquet of cassis, dark plum preserves, and black cherries, gracefully interwoven with classic Pauillac notes of pencil lead graphite, cedarwood, cigar box, cured leather, and damp forest floor. On the palate, it is medium-to-full-bodied, supple, and beautifully balanced, where the estate's traditionally muscular tannins have softened into fine velvet, enlivened by a fresh spine of natural acidity that carries into a long, dry, and savory mineral finish.

Highlights

  • Vintage: 1997

  • Region/Appellation: Pauillac, Médoc, Bordeaux, France (Deuxième Grand Cru Classé / Second Growth)

  • Producer: Château Pichon-Longueville Baron

  • Grape: Classic Bordeaux Blend (Predominantly Cabernet Sauvignon, with Merlot and Cabernet Franc)

  • Style: Fully Mature, Savory, Silky, and Refined Super Second Red Bordeaux

  • Perfect for (food pairing): Fine cuts of slow-roasted rack of lamb with a garlic-herb crust, dry-aged prime ribeye or wagyu steak, roasted squab, pan-seared duck breast, or tender venison loin. Its complex tertiary notes of cedarwood, graphite, tobacco, and forest floor also make it a magnificent companion for pan-seared wild mushrooms, truffled risottos, savory earth-driven pastas, or a well-curated plate of mature hard cheeses such as an aged Comté or Gouda.
